He <br />is agreeable. <br />On August 24, 1987 the city council adopted Ordinance No. 17 -87, an <br />amendment to the zoning ordinance. Section 4, Subd. 4 (G) was <br />amended to state in part: <br />(G) Pole barn construction and sheet metal exteriors may be <br />permitted in all commercial and industrial districts as <br />a conditional use under the following circumstances: <br />(3) As an expansion of a pole barn. The expansion shall not <br />be more than 50 per cent of the gross area of the pole <br />barn as of the date of the passage of this ordinance. <br />The city shall attach conditions to the expansion to <br />maintain and enhance the appearance and function of the <br />building including landscaping and building <br />The board members discussed the conditions that must be met in <br />order for the conditional use to be granted.
